Three dead, 50 injured as train derails in Assam

Three people were dead and at least 50 passengers injured when the engine and five compartments of a train derailed after hitting an earth-cutting vehicle on its track in Kamrup (Rural) district of Assam today.

The Bongaigaon-Guwahati Chilarai Passenger train rammed into the vehicle and stuck on the track at Gossainghati between Azara and Mirza railway stations leaving about 50 injured around 9.30am, railway sources said.

The injured passengers were rushed by the local people to the Mirza Public Health Centre from where the critically injured were referred to the Gauhati Medical College Hospital, police said.

Railway officials along with rescue vans have rushed to the spot, railway sources said.
